From b386ef9106adbfcbed0ea2df48fa6cfb8908abd5 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=98=89=E5=A4=9A=E5=AE=9D=E5=AE=9D?= Date: Fri, 23 Jan 2026 15:29:04 +0800 Subject: [PATCH] =?UTF-8?q?fix:=E4=BF=AE=E5=A4=8DBug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../user/admin/service/impl/AdminUserServiceImpl.java |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/seer-user/seer-user-service-admin/src/main/java/com/seer/teach/user/admin/service/impl/AdminUserServiceImpl.java b/seer-user/seer-user-service-admin/src/main/java/com/seer/teach/user/admin/service/impl/AdminUserServiceImpl.java index 7929dfe..7ccb2fb 100644 --- a/seer-user/seer-user-service-admin/src/main/java/com/seer/teach/user/admin/service/impl/AdminUserServiceImpl.java +++ b/seer-user/seer-user-service-admin/src/main/java/com/seer/teach/user/admin/service/impl/AdminUserServiceImpl.java @@ -140,6 +140,13 @@ public class AdminUserServiceImpl implements AdminUserService { AssertUtils.notNull(adminUserEntity,ResultCodeEnum.USER_NOT_FOUND); UserEntity userEntity = AdminUserConvert.INSTANCE.convertOne(params); + // 如果密码不为空,则修改密码 + if (params.getPassword() != null && !params.getPassword().isEmpty()) { + String password = CommonUtils.encryptPassword(params.getPassword()); + userEntity.setPassword(password); + } else { + userEntity.setPassword(adminUserEntity.getPassword()); + } userEntity.setId(id); userService.updateById(userEntity); }